PRODUCT DETAILS

The WNMU050408EN carbide shoulder milling insert is a compact, high-precision insert designed for small and medium-depth shoulder milling. It features a stable cutting edge and efficient chip control, delivering excellent performance in general CNC applications.

Features:

  • Optimized cutting edge for low cutting resistance

  • Suitable for semi-finishing and finishing operations

  • High-performance carbide substrate for durability

  • Smooth chip evacuation for better surface finish

  • Reliable in both dry and wet cutting conditions

Applications:
Perfect for machining carbon steel, stainless steel, and alloy steels in precision engineering and mold manufacturing industries.

Product Advantages:

  • Cost-effective double-sided design

  • Consistent surface finish and dimensional accuracy

  • Compatible with standard milling cutters

WNMU050408EN Specifications:

Model

ap

(mm)

f

(mm/rev)

Grade
CVD
PVD
KA3115 PA4215 PA4225 PA1025 PA1825 MA1525 SA1520 SA1525
WNMU050408EN-GM 0.5-5.0 0.10-0.30



Inserts Grade Information:

ISO Application CVD PVD
P Steel PA4215/PA4225/PA4235 PA1015/PA1025/PA1825
M Stainless steel MA1820/MA1824/MA1828/MA1525
K Cast iron KA3020/KA3040/KA3115
S Superalloy
SA1029/SA1510/SA1525/SA1605/SA1610
N Aluminum NA10
H High hardness material HA1009
